Huntington Ingalls to Post Q4 Earnings: What's in the Cards?

Read MoreHide Full Article

Key Takeaways

  • HII is expected to benefit from higher sales volumes across Ingalls, Newport News and Mission Technologies.
  • HII's surface combatant, submarine, carrier and C5ISR programs are projected to lift segment revenues.
  • HII's Q4 sales are estimated at $3.06B, up 1.8% year over year, with EPS projected to rise 18.1%.

Huntington Ingalls Industries, Inc. (HII - Free Report) is scheduled to release fourth-quarter 2025 earnings on Feb. 5, 2026, before market open. The company delivered an earnings surprise of 11.85% in the last reported quarter.

Let’s discuss the factors that are likely to be reflected in the upcoming quarterly results.

Factors Likely to Affect HII’s Q4 Results

Higher sales volume from surface combatants is likely to have boosted the Ingalls segment’s top line in the fourth quarter.

Higher sales volumes from submarine and aircraft carrier programs are likely to have boosted the Newport News segment’s revenue performance.

Higher sales volumes from C5ISR (Command, Control, Computers, Communications, Cyber, Intelligence, Surveillance and Reconnaissance) and live, virtual and constructive training solutions are likely to have bolstered the company’s Mission Technologies segment’s revenues in the fourth quarter of 2025.

Q4 Estimates for HII Stock

Sales growth anticipated across all three of its major segments is likely to have boosted the company’s overall fourth-quarter financial performance.

The Zacks Consensus Estimate for HII’s fourth-quarter sales is pegged at $3.06 billion, which indicates an increase of 1.8% from the prior-year number.

The consensus estimate for HII’s earnings is pegged at $3.72 per share, which indicates a year-over-year increase of 18.1%.
